From 6fcbc0f3261443bc35bc5552c212e381ae9c464c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Daniel Wagner Date: Wed, 31 Jan 2024 09:51:09 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] nvmet-fc: abort command when there is no binding [ Upstream commit 3146345c2e9c2f661527054e402b0cfad80105a4 ] When the target port has not active port binding, there is no point in trying to process the command as it has to fail anyway. Instead adding checks to all commands abort the command early.
